A fixed action pattern (FAP) is a specific, hard-wired sequence of behaviors that occurs in response to an external stimulus, called a sign stimulus. The behavior is “fixed” because it is essentially unchangeable—proceeding similarly across individuals of a species every time it occurs.

Antibodies, also known as immunoglobulins, are produced by B cells in response to foreign substances, such as bacteria and viruses. These proteins are critical for recognizing and neutralizing these substances, protecting the body from potential harm.
The basic structure of an antibody consists of four protein chains: two identical heavy chains and two identical light chains. These chains are held together by disulfide bonds and other non-covalent interactions, forming a Y-shaped structure.

在多变量分类数据中,用于非可忽视的非响应的潜在类型模式混合模型.

Jungwun Lee1, Margaret Lloyd Sieger2, Jon D Phillips3

  • 1Department of Biostatistics, Boston University School of Public Health, 801 Massachusetts Ave, Boston, 02118, MA, United States.

Computational statistics
|February 5, 2026
PubMed
概括

这项研究引入了一个新模型来处理缺失的调查数据,这对心理学和教育研究至关重要. 它识别了响应和缺失数据的独特模式,提高了分析有效性.

科学领域:

  • 统计 统计 统计 统计
  • 心理测量 心理测量 心理测量
  • 行为科学 行为科学

背景情况:

  • 具有分类变量的调查数据在心理学,教育和行为研究中很常见.
  • 这些数据中的不可忽视的缺失值可能会损害统计推断的有效性.
  • 现有的方法可能无法充分解决分类结果中的复杂缺失模式.

研究的目的:

  • 为分析多变量分类结果中不可忽视的缺失值提出一种新的潜在模式混合模型.
  • 提供可靠的统计方法来处理复杂的调查设计中缺少的数据.
  • 为了提高从缺少数据的调查研究中得出的推断的有效性.

主要方法:

  • 开发一个含有两个类别隐性变量的隐性模式混合模型:一个用于非响应模式,另一个用于非响应条件下的响应模式.
  • 实施两个参数估计策略:通过预期最大化 (EM) 算法实现最大概率 (ML) 和使用马尔科夫链蒙特卡洛 (MCMC) 的贝叶斯估计.
  • 进行模拟研究以比较ML和贝叶斯估计方法在不同样本大小下的性能.

主要成果:

  • 模拟研究表明,由于较低的标准化偏差,对大样本大小的最大概率估计通常是首选的.
  • 使用非信息先验的贝叶斯估计在较小的样本大小中显示出优势.
  • 一个真实数据示例在一项关于家长物质使用障碍的研究中确定了六个不同的隐藏类,其特点是独特的响应和缺失模式.

结论:

  • 拟议的隐藏模式混合模型提供了一个灵活的框架,用于解决分类调查研究中不可忽视的缺失数据.
  • ML和贝叶斯估计方法都是可行的,最佳选择取决于样本大小.
  • 该模型有效地揭示了响应和缺失的基础结构,有助于应用研究中的解释.
